Etymology & Heritage
The name Jovie is of American origin and has been popularized in recent years, thanks to a broader general trend towards more creative, unique, and original names for children. Even though it became popular recently, the origins of the name can be traced back to an older root.
In essence, the name is believed to share a connection with the Latin Jovis, which denotes of Jupiter, resonating with themes of abundant power and influence, as Jupiter, in Roman mythology, is known as the king of gods.
Character & Essence
While Jovie in Latin refers to Jupiter, in our present context it resonates with joy and jolliness. The phonetics of the name Jovie align closely with the word jovial, which means cheerful and friendly.
As such, the name Jovie is often associated with a person who embodies cheerfulness, friendliness, and joyfulness. The name carries an inherent radiance and convivial optimism, drawing together elements of ancient mythology and modern-day culture.
Cultural & Contemporary Significance
A popular use of the name Jovie stemmed from cinema. The name was brought into the limelight by the character of Jovie in the popular 2003 Christmas film Elf. Jovie, played by actress Zooey Deschanel, charmed the audiences with her joyous spirit and warmth that beautifully articulates the inherent qualities associated with the name: friendliness, cheerfulness, and an overall jovial personality.
The name is not widely used, which adds an element of uniqueness, yet it is easily pronounced and spelled, contributing to its quiet charm, much like the character who popularized it in popular culture.
